Cost Analyst

Accurately maintain the standard costing environment including system controls, structure, and standard cost rolls
Identify, review, and explain manufacturing variances
Month end close processes, journal entries, and analyses
Cost center reporting, validation, and attestation of Sku's with the ability to bridge actual variances versus budgets
Reconcile cost/production/inventory systems to the balance sheet
Raw egg, ingredient, packaging, WIP, and finished good inventory cutoff procedures (including in-transit accounting)
Support forecasting of monthly material usage and spend based on sales demand at direction of assistant controller
Generate weekly production dashboard to measure against key performance indicators
Generate models and tools to create efficiencies and manage by exception reports
Collaborate with conducted cost studies and prepare/present findings and recommendations
Financial partnership on future production changes (expansion/reductions, efficiencies/impact)
Collaborate with Operations in conducting capital investment analysis
Audit internal controls at plant level and identify areas of cost reduction/control
Support, create, and update standard operating procedures (SOP's) and accounting policies
Support annual budgeting process and capital requisition requests
Take appropriate action to ensure the integrity and sustained certification of the SQF system
Responsible for reporting and taking any necessary action to prevent food safety and food quality problems from occurring
Responsible for following and enforcing procedures outlined in the Food Safety Plan and the Food Quality Plan and any other programs that support the SQF system and other 3rd party audits
Perform other tasks as assigned

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
